Output 26427669ab36b36a310e5f0f131695a51b4b118d22edf243aee6e5733fa5c3d9:1

value
893764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ba812ffd3fb2294b85488fd33a434696380dbd4 OP_EQUAL
address
378T8s1S56xvNHAAV7m8Qa2Ehdonz7vRvG
transaction
26427669ab36b36a310e5f0f131695a51b4b118d22edf243aee6e5733fa5c3d9
spent
true